On the H1 Freeway in the Eastbound direction (in the Kaimuki area), under the Westbound off-ramp to Kapiolani Boulevard, there is a large pillar (for the off-ramp) and wedge-shaped space (under the off-ramp).
LE hides on the far side of the pillar in that space, and is not visible until you pass by and then it is too late. The unit then moves-into traffic, accelerating to follow the targeted vehice for a pull-over. In heavy traffic motorists seem unsure of just who is being pulled over, so traffic gets 'confused' for a bit until the targeted vehicle is singled-out.
People who frequent that section will be familiar; just a heads-up when heading home at night, or even during the day after work because of the sudden congestion and lane changes by other cars.
